The Mint Million – Grade III
1 Mile Turf Stake Purse $2,500.000 Open 3 Year Olds And Up.
1st Oh Brother Spankys Barn Gaffalione T
A wet track muddied the waters a bit in this race but this six-year-old is a big day sort of horse and captured his third grade one with a strong finish. Just behind them last year in the BC Mile, he will head there again and may even be racing a little better this year, so he may just get the BC title he probably deserves.
2nd Hawaiian Lord Our Athletes Geroux F
Using the wide gate speed push, he went on-speed and had made the lead by halfway. He battled on very bravely but just couldn’t hold the winner going down by a half-length at the post. This horse is the perennial bridesmaid, a title that can be detrimental but in his case, I use it with admiration as he scored his 18th second place which must be somewhere near a record.
3rd Sick Boi Royalty Stables Curtis B
As expected, the wide gate sent him all the way back, but he doesn’t mind a wet track and that showed as he made up a ton of ground in the stretch and was only beaten a length in the end. His running style on this engine is severely penalized but, on his day, when conditions and pace suit, he is very good.
4th Seven Is Lucky Mb Stables Franco M
Sat in a loose stalk and kept on pretty well for fourth in what was his best effort for a while.
